Each episode focuses on an individual designer and their work which may be across a range of diverse industries. It provides a fascinating insight into the world of cutting edge design and the people who drive innovations. Among the individuals profiled are two Australians, automotive designer Max Wolff and Marc Newson who has worked across a range of mediums including furniture, homewares, watches, a bicycle and even a private jet.

2x01 Zaha Hadid

  • 2009-11-08T13:00:00Z30m

In this episode, we meet Zaha Hadid, the first woman to win the Pritzker Prize for Architecture in its 26 year history. Zaha's radical approach to architecture involves creating buildings with multiple perspective points and fragmented geometry to evoke the chaos of modern life.
